About the Book

Corpse Magic examines beliefs about vengeance the slain magically enact on their killers, focusing on lethal violence in Colombia and the United States. Corpse Magic is a response to the global ubiquity of violence. In this bracing new work, the influential anthropologist Michael Taussig puts killings in Colombia, by gangs and guerrillas, police and the military, and agents of agribusiness, in conversation with mass shootings and police killings, disproportionately of Black people, in the United States. In both contexts, he examines the effects of violent killing on its victims, its perpetrators, and those who witness and relive it through media footage. Drawing from literature, religion, philosophy, and anthropology, Taussig traces the idea that the act of killing "infects" the killer and spreads outward, then connects this concept of contagion to beliefs in Colombia and elsewhere that the souls of the slain possess those of their slayers and that magic can be used to empower or thwart corpses as agents of vengeance. In this powerful and imaginative work, Taussig asks what kind of power the dead continue to have; what kinds of magic can manage that power; and what, if anything, can stop seemingly endless cycles of violence.

About the Author :
Michael Taussig is emeritus professor of anthropology at Columbia University. He is the author of many books, including And the Garden Is You and Mastery of Non-Mastery in the Age of Meltdown, both published by the University of Chicago Press.
